Job DescriptionPOSITION SUMMARY: Check inbound meat/produce and current stock in order to ensure freshness and quality of product
distributed to member stores.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S: - Ensure only quality product is received and shipped by AWG by inspecting inbound loads
regarding questionable quality or condition and determine proper handling. - Provide reasonable assurance that all incoming products conform to written and approved
quality and weight specifications by conducting random audits. - Inspect quality in slot to confirm optimum quality for retail.
- Monitor stock in perishable coolers/freezers verifying that proper rotation procedures have
been observed, reporting any rotation or date problems. - Examine returned merchandise and damaged cases to determine disposition of product.
- Ripen bananas to the optimum color for member stores.
- Observe that bananas pulled for order selecting are pulled from the proper banana rooms
and properly covered. - Report inventory levels, shelf life, shrinkage, and other quality related areas on a timely basis
to Buyers and Sales Managers. - Be actively involved in identifying and correcting any problem areas in the distribution center
which may impact the quality of perishable products such as temperatures, method of
loading, product rotation, etc. - Inspect all loads of inbound meat products for proper temperature control, Country of Origin
and HACCP. Documenting all pertinent information as required for proper governmental
compliance.
IMPORTANT FUNCTIONS: - Evaluate damaged cases and repair if possible.
- Use computer to monitor inbound trucks, query product location and dating. Make any
necessary adjustments to inventory. - Check and monitor temperatures of inbound product and perishable zones where meat and
produce products are stored/received/shipped and that they are properly maintained. - Turn in weekly/daily reports to the Buyers and Sales Manager regarding product aging.
- Provide the Sales Managers information concerning billbacks to ensure proper deductions
are made when appropriate. - Perform other duties as requested by the Sales Manager or Fresh Director.
- Collect and return temperature recorders to appropriate vendors.
- Maintain QA tools and supplies (inventory on hand/needed) and calibrate temperature
recorders.
